Getting into a hit-and-miss accident can be a terrifying and overwhelming experience. Whether you are a driver, pedestrian, or cyclist, it’s crucial to know what to do in the aftermath of an accident.

Here are the steps to take after a hit-and-miss accident.

1. Check for injuries

The first thing to do is to check if you or anyone else involved in the accident is injured. If anyone requires medical attention, call 911 immediately. It’s essential to prioritize the health and safety of everyone involved.

2. Move to a safe location

If possible, move the vehicles or yourself to a safe location away from traffic. This will help avoid further accidents and ensure your safety.

3. Exchange information

After ensuring everyone’s safety, exchange information with the other party involved in the accident. You’ll need their name, phone number, address, and insurance information. If there were any witnesses, get their contact information as well.

4. Document the accident scene

Document the accident scene by taking photos and videos. Capture images of the vehicles involved, the location of the accident, and any visible damage to the vehicles. These records can help with insurance claims and legal proceedings.

5. Contact your insurance company

Contact your insurance company as soon as possible and provide them with all the details of the accident. They will guide you through the process of filing a claim and help you understand your coverage.

6. Seek legal advice

If the accident resulted in injuries or significant damage to the vehicles, you might want to consider seeking legal advice. A lawyer can help you navigate the legal process and protect your rights.

7. Follow up on medical treatment

If you sustained any injuries, follow up on medical treatment. Ensure you attend all your appointments and follow the doctor’s orders. This will help you recover faster and ensure you get the compensation you deserve.
